A 33-year-old woman with a known severe peanut allergy inadvertently eats a dessert containing peanuts. Ten minutes later she develops generalised urticaria, lip swelling, throat tightness, and wheeze. Blood pressure is 95/60 mm Hg. What is the most appropriate initial treatment?
